The Honda X4 was a Liquid cooled, four stroke, transverse four cylinders Naked motorcycle produced by Honda in 1997. It could reach a top speed of 118 mph (190 km/h). Max torque was 89.25 ft/lbs (121.0 Nm) @ 5000 RPM. Claimed horsepower was 100.04 HP (74.6 KW) @ 6500 RPM.

Engine

The engine was a liquid cooled Liquid cooled, four stroke, transverse four cylinders. A 76.2mm bore x 76.2mm stroke result in a displacement of just 1284.0 cubic centimeters.

Drive

The bike has a 5 Speed transmission.

Chassis

It came with a 120/70-18 front tire and a 190/60-17 rear tire. Stopping was achieved via 2x310mm discs 4 piston calipers in the front and a Single 276mm disc 1 piston caliper in the rear. The X4 was fitted with a 1.06 Gallon (4.00 Liters) fuel tank. The wheelbase was 65.0 inches (1651 mm) long.

The Japanese manufacturer manufactured by the X4 LD motorcycle as a reply to Yamaha's Vmax, the company improving it several times in the next few years. For instance, the 2000 model comes with a lower seat, overall frame and improved suspension.
